The first single off the EP, also named “Rain Break”, demonstrates a darker tone than Claude VonStroke’s previously released tracks, like “Barrump” and “Make A Cake”. While the Dirtybird boss mentioned on his radio show, The Birdhouse, that the inspiration for the track came from humming the bass line of Raze’s “Break For Love” with the vocals from Oran Juice Jones’ “The Rain”, the track itself actually features Claude VonStoke’s vocals as he covers the chorus from “The Rain”.
Claude VonStroke – The Rain Break [OFFICIAL VIDEO]
The video for the new single seems to follow a similar storyline to Oran Juice Jones’ video for “The Rain”, as they both follow a person who finds their significant other kissing someone else, but Claude VonStroke’s version takes a darker twist, showing that while revenge might be best served cold, sometimes a little more heat is necessary.
